Benefits of Erosion Control Hydroseeding Service
Erosion Control Hydroseeding service offers a range of benefits for landowners and property developers. Here are five key advantages:
1. Environmentally Friendly
Hydroseeding is an environmentally friendly erosion control method that uses a mixture of grass seed, mulch, fertilizer, and water. This method helps to establish vegetation quickly, preventing soil erosion and promoting natural habitat restoration.
2. Cost-Effective
Compared to traditional methods such as sodding or hand-seeding, hydroseeding is a cost-effective solution. The process is efficient and requires fewer labor hours, resulting in reduced labor costs. Additionally, hydroseeding materials are typically less expensive than sod or other erosion control methods.
3. Rapid and Uniform Growth
Hydroseeding promotes rapid and uniform growth of vegetation. The mixture of grass seed and mulch creates an ideal environment for seed germination, ensuring consistent coverage and a lush, green lawn or landscape in a shorter time frame.
4. Erosion Prevention
One of the primary benefits of hydroseeding is its ability to prevent erosion. The mulch and tackifiers in the hydroseed mixture create a protective layer that binds the soil, preventing it from being washed away by rain or wind. This helps to stabilize slopes, reduce sediment runoff, and protect against soil erosion.
5. Versatility
Hydroseeding is a versatile solution that can be used in various applications, including residential lawns, commercial landscapes, golf courses, sports fields, and highway construction sites. It can be customized to suit different soil types, slopes, and project requirements, making it a flexible option for erosion control.
